Author: David Barton.

Amplifies the contrasting views on public policy by the Founding Fathers with the current decline in honesty and integrity in government. Founding Fathers such as Benjamin Rush Noah Webster and Fisher Ames outlined principles for successful government as a legacy for future Americans.

Read and learn how to reclaim the quality of government our people once enjoyed when this nation was truly "One Nation Under God!"
